These Hall-effect switches are monolithic integrated circuits with tighter magnetic specifications, designed to operate continuously over extended temperatures to +150°C, and are more stable with both temperature and supply voltage changes. The unipolar switching characteristic makes these devices ideal for use with a simple bar or rod magnet. The three basic devices (A3121, A3122, and A3123) are identical except for magnetic switch points.
Each device includes a voltage
regulator for operation with supply voltages of 4.5 volts to 24 volts, reverse battery protection diode, quadratic Hall-voltage generator, temperature compensation circuitry, smallsignal amplifier, Schmitt trigger, and an open-collector output to sink up to 25 mA.
